Winifred was born in UK, her mother and father ran a pub in UK, and when she was 17 they migrated to South Africa. She had a sister in the UK, but she died of consumption.

Her father had migrated a few years earlier. After arriving in South Africa to join her father, they could not find him. They battled initially, and stayed with Aunty Kitty, in the old Tin and Wood house in Malan Street, Riviera, Pretoria. Later they found her father - he had created a new life for himself ... so her mother divorced him.

They were good cooks / bakers, and her mother later started a Tea Room called "The Singing Kettle" in Kudu's arcade, Pretoria. In later years it became quite famous. I remember my grandmothers famous baking - shortbread was amazing, but my favourite was her chocolate cakes ... not too chocolaty, light and delicious - to this day I cannot eat another chocolate cake.

She married Henry Nebel , but in her later years they were divorced.

Winifred lived her later life in Queenswood, Pretoria, South Africa till her death. She was near her children and their families, and most of us frequently visited her at her 3rd floor flat.
